This volume provides a comparative assessment of individual labour dispute settlement systems in nine OECD countries (Australia, Canada, France, Germany, Japan, Spain, Sweden, the United Kingdom and the United States), together with a synthetic over-view of the key features across these systems.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) refers to the dispute mechanisms that have been introduced in order to resolve disputes in an expeditious and cost-effective manner, as opposed to costly and time consuming litigations. Mediation is effectively used in alternative dispute resolution as it provides the disputing parties with the opportunity to reach a mutually acceptable solution themselves, through the guidance of a neutral third party, the mediator. The objective of public policy is to manage conflict and promote sound labour relations by creating a system for the effective prevention and settlement of labour disputes.Labour administrations typically establish labour dispute procedures in national legislation. Labour relations law, enacted in all jurisdictions in Canada, makes requirements for a dispute resolution mechanism to be set in place to resolve disputes, before these disputes lead to work stoppages or strike action.
